Finding a material to replace the the back covering would be a large step forward in terms of uniformity.
The front/ sides have index of refraction for Water/Glass/ Air of 1.3/1.5/1.0
The back is Water/Glass/Acrylic (paint binder) 1.3/1.5/1.5
There are no standard materials with an index of refraction close to air, so the ideal solution may be a false back. Something like those plastic sheet window insulation kits would work. Apply some double sided foam black tape around the perimeter, roll out black plastic wrap, cut it then use a hair dryer to make it tight.
